ABSTRACT:
An activated carbon is modified to have bactericidal properties and/or an additional ability to remove heavy metals and other toxic substances. Said modified activated carbon is especially suitable for purifying drinking water and can be readily modified to be suitable for various regions with specific tap water impurities. Pursuant to the invention, activated carbon fiber is treated to adsorb a member of the group consisting of cations, anions, organic complex forming agents, surfactants, polyelectrolytes and organic bactericidal compounds.
